The Rev. Dwight M. Kitch, pastor of the First Methodist church of Ionia, will officiate, and burial will be in the Saranac cemetery. Mrs. Scott was born July 29, 1870, in Campbell township, and had resided in Saranac for 25 years, until two years ago, when she moved to Ionia to live with her daughter. Surviving besides Mrs. Conner are two sons, Sheldon A. Rose of Saranac and R. G. Scott of Munster, Ind.; eight grandchildren, six great grandchildren, and two half sisters, Mrs. Flora Heaven of Clarksville and Mrs. Jack Scalley of Flint. Mrs. Scott was a life member of the Saranac order of the Eastern Star. The body will repose at the home of her son, Sheldon, until Tuesday morning, when it will be taken to the Morris funeral home for services.
